Airtel invests in telecom networks in Kumbakonam

Airtel network
Indian telecom network operator Bharti Airtel has made additional investment in its networks in Kumbakonam and its adjacent towns ahead of Mahamaham festival in Tamil Nadu.

Airtel, India’s number one 4G operator based on its network coverage, aims to offer better customer experience to about 50 lakh people who attend Mahamaham festival that happens every 12 years.

Bharti Airtel has added temporary telecom sites with higher capacity near Mahamaham Tank and Portramarai Tank, COW sites at all temporary bus stands and new sites around the temple in Kumbakonam.

The company has also expanded capacity of sites in Kumbakonam and adjacent towns of Tanjore, Trichy, Tiruvarur and Mayiladuthurai to accommodate additional traffic.

Earlier, Bharti Airtel had provided enhanced coverage during Book Fair and Global Investors Meet in Chennai, Tamil Nadu.

George Mathen, hub CEO – Kerala & Tamil Nadu, Bharti Airtel, said: “In a bid to provide seamless voice & data connectivity and accommodate additional traffic during Mahamaham festival for the pilgrims, we have bolstered our network in Kumbakonam and adjacent towns.”
